Sunreef Yachts 114′ CHE: The Biggest Sloop Catamaran to Prowl the Seas

Sunreef Yachts announces the launch of their largest custom-built superyacht catamaran, the Sunreef 114 CHE, the third largest catamaran in the world. Although details have not yet been made public the sloop-rigged catamaran promises to be an extremely popular option for chartering in the Caribbean this winter. An open architecture floor plan allows for unobstructed central social areas plus three staterooms and two crew cabins nestled comfortably within the hulls. CHE benefits from expansive and beautifully appointed exterior space ideal for sun worship, dining al fresco, or having fun on one of two trampolines. CHE will be completed at the Sunreef docks in Gdansk, Poland, within the next couple of months.

Sunreef 102' Double Deck IPHARRA, the second largest build launched from the yard last April, has successfully completed sea trials, achieved systems certification by Bureau Veritas and has set sail. Most notably, her double deck flybridge brings this yacht to a whole new level, comfortably furnished for dining, relaxation, or taking a turn at the helm. IPHARRA can currently be spotted in the Eastern Mediterranean prior to making her way to the Caribbean for the winter charter season.
